Brief Biography

M.B. Plotnikov graduated from the Biology Faculty of Tomsk State University in 1971 with a degree "biophysics". From 1971 he worked at the Department of Pharmacology of the Tomsk Medical Institute as a senior laboratory assistant, then as an assistant and senior teacher. In 1986, he was hired as a senior researcher, and in 1987 he was transferred to the position of head of the Laboratory of Circulatory Pharmacology at the Institute of Pharmacology, Academy of Medical Sciences of the USSR. Doctor of Biological Sciences (1985), professor in the specialty "Pharmacology" (2003).

Research Interests

M.B. Plotnikov is a leading specialist in the field of circulatory pharmacology. He is the author of more than 500 publications, including 8 monographs (3 of them were published in the USA), more than 50 inventions protected by copyright certificates of the USSR and patents of the Russian Federation. M.B. Plotnikov was a member of the authors' teams for the preparation of the Guidelines for the conduct of preclinical studies of drugs (Moscow, 2013). Under his leadership 3 doctoral dissertations and 19 master's theses have been prepared and defended. Under the leadership of M.B. Plotnikov and with his direct participation developed more than 10 new drugs, of which 2 were included in the State Register and are produced by the pharmaceutical industry, one drug successfully passed clinical studies, and for a number of others a full cycle of preclinical studies was conducted.

Achievements, awards, and grants

The creation of M.B. Plotnikov and his team of new drugs were repeatedly supported by grants from state funds: the Federal Target Program “Development of the pharmaceutical and medical industry of the Russian Federation for the period up to 2020 and beyond” (grants 16.N08.12.1007, 16.N08.12.1006, 14.N08. 12.0002, 14.N08.12.0029), RFBR (grants 05-03-08149, 06-04-08006 and 07-04-08006), Federal Target Program "Research and development on priority problems of the development of the scientific and technological complex of Russia for 2007-2012" (Grant 02.512.11.2229), of the Foundation for Assistance to the Development of Small Forms of Enterprises in the Scientific and Technical Sphere (grant 05-6-N2-0018), Federal Target Program “Research and development in priority areas for the development of science and technology for civilian use” (grant 02/5 of January 14, 2000), Administration of Tomsk Region (grants 1999, 2000). In 2000, M.B. Plotnikov won the Russian biomedical projects competition held by Fraunhofer Management GmbH (Germany), the results of which he was invited to participate in the presentation of his project at the Analytics 2000 exhibition in Munich.
M.B. Plotnikov was awarded the title "Honored Worker of Science of the Russian Federation" (2010), he was awarded the Certificate of Honor of the Presidium of the Russian Academy of Medical Sciences and the Badge of Excellence in Healthcare of the Russian Federation (2005). For a significant contribution to medical science and health care, the team of the laboratory headed by M.B. Plotnikov, became the winner of the Tomsk Region Prize in Education and Science (2000). M.B. Plotnikov was elected a member of the New York Academy of Sciences, awarded with an individual grant of the ISF (Soros Foundation, 1993) and an individual grant of the Russian Academy of Sciences for distinguished scientists (2001-2003).
